BanksForge
Banks near me
Find
Find
Santander Bank Locations
Santander Bank Hours
Santander Bank ATMs
Santander Bank ATM
Santander Bank ATM
Address
4 Broadway Rd
Dracut
MA 01826
United States
Phone
:(877) 768-2265
Open 24 Hours a Day:No